dc.description.abstractSafety is one of the crucial features of autonomous systems. Safe decision-making is a critical and challenging task in developing such systems. To address this challenge, we proposed vGOAL, a GOAL-based specification language designed for ensuring safe autonomous decision-making. In this paper, we present an interpreter for vGOAL, serving as an agent-based decision-making component for autonomous systems. Our main contributions are the design and implementation of the vGOAL interpreter, which automatically and efficiently generates safe decisions in real-time, while simultaneously performing safety checking, error handling, and conflict resolution for competing requests. As the Robot Operating System is a popular framework for developing robotic application systems, we integrate the vGOAL interpreter with it via rosbridge. To demonstrate the effectiveness of vGOAL, we validated its performance using a real-world autonomous logistic system comprising three autonomous mobile robots.
